Abstract
The invention discloses a kind of electronic limits to trolley, including car body and wheel, it further include locking device and control circuit, the locking device includes crossbeam and abutting block, the crossbeam is fixed on the bottom of car body, and crossbeam is provided with the cavity of downwardly facing opening, and the cavity of crossbeam is rotatably connected to shaft, it abuts block to be fixedly connected with shaft, abuts any one side of block and abutted with the surface of wheel;The control circuit includes motor, hall sensor and micro process control unit;The front end of car body is arranged in the hall sensor, and motor is rotated for drive shaft.During cart, if barrier occurs in car body front end, hall sensor is passed the signal in MCU Microprocessor Control Unit, and rotate shaft by MCU Microprocessor Control Unit control motor, it drives abutting block to abut with wheel, stops the movement of trolley, prevent unexpected generation.

Specific embodiment
Referring to figs. 1 to Fig. 3, a kind of electronic limit of the invention further includes to trolley, including car body 100 and wheel 200
Locking device 300 and control circuit, the locking device 300 include crossbeam 310 and abut block 330, and the crossbeam 310 is fixed on
The bottom of car body 100, crossbeam 310 are provided with the cavity of downwardly facing opening, and the cavity of crossbeam 310 is rotatably connected to shaft 320, abut
Block 330 is fixedly connected with shaft 320, is abutted any one side of block 330 and is abutted with the surface of wheel 200;The control circuit
Including motor, hall sensor 410 and micro process control unit;The front end of car body 100 is arranged in the hall sensor 410,
For receiving the direction of motion, whether there are obstacles and transmits information in MCU Microprocessor Control Unit;Micro process control unit
For receiving and processing the information from hall sensor 410, the closure or openness of motor are controlled;Motor is used for drive shaft
320 rotations.
In actual use, in cart, if barrier occurs in 100 front end of car body, hall sensor 410 is by signal
It is transmitted in MCU Microprocessor Control Unit, and rotates shaft 320 by MCU Microprocessor Control Unit control motor, drive and abut
Block 330 is abutted with wheel 200, stops the movement of trolley, prevents unexpected generation.
As an improvement of the above technical solution, the abutting block 330 is arranged to zigzag with what wheel 200 abutted on one side.
The frictional force abutted between block 330 and wheel 200 is improved, the movement of wheel 200 is more effectively stopped.
As a further improvement of the above technical scheme, the rear end of the car body 100 is provided with handle 110.It is convenient to use
Person pushes trolley.
Preferably, the surface of the car body 100 is provided with battery case, and battery, battery and electricity are provided in the battery case
Mechatronics.It is directly powered by battery, does not need extended electric wire, improve safety.
Preferably, the surface of the handle 110 is covered with anti-skidding sponge.Effectively improve safety.
